The manufacturing fdi for 2022 (january to september) was approximately us$14 billion. the manufacturing sector’s contribution to india’s economy is still comparatively low, coming in at 15 percent in 2023 after having stagnated in the range of 13 17 percent for more than 20 years. Yet india experienced a relatively strong recovery in 2021. with year on year growth of 13.4% taking manufacturing output to just over $1 trillion in 2021, in fact india became the global leader in manufacturing growth for that year, but much of that was reciprocal pressure as the sector recovered from the steep dip in 2020. India is on the verge of becoming a global manufacturing hub owing to the increased impetus laid by the government on indigenous production. the "make in india" initiative and the production linked incentive (pli) scheme are two notable government programmes from which manufacturing companies can benefit.
